English
Noun
DV (countable and uncountable, plural DVs)
- (television) Initialism of digital video.
2020, Emily St. John Mandel, The Glass Hotel, Picador (2021), page 67:Vincent opened it and found a video camera, a Panasonic. She recognized it as one of the new kind that took DV tapes, but it still had an unexpected weight.
- Initialism of domestic violence.
- (television) Initialism of described video.
- (nutrition) Initialism of daily value.
- (medicine) Initialism of Doctors Vote.
